Our Mold Remediation Process in North Port, Florida:

  • Thorough Inspection and Assessment: Our trained mold specialists in North Port, Florida start with a comprehensive inspection of your building. This process involves:
    • Visual Examination:Detecting visible mold, as well as areas affected by moisture.
    • Moisture Mapping: Employing advanced mo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to detect concealed moisture sources within walls, ceilings, and flooring. This is especially vital in a region like North Port, Florida, where humidity changes can be extreme.
  • Identifying Water Intrusion Points: Locating roof leaks, plumbing leaks, foundation cracks, or insufficient ventilation that contribute to elevated moisture conditions.
  • Understanding Airflow Dynamics: Assessing ventilation systems, particularly high-humidity areas such as bathrooms, kitchens, and basements common mold problem areas in North Port, Florida homes.
  • Advanced Mold Testing: Even though a visual inspection often confirms mold, testing provides critical data.
    • Air Sampling: To accurately measure the concentration and species of mold spores present in the indoor air, both inside the affected area and outside for comparison. This enables professionals to evaluate the extent of airborne contamination and associated health risks.
    • Surface Sampling: Surface swabs or tape lifts may be taken from questionable surfaces to confirm specific mold species and verify growth patterns, shaping our remediation strategy.
  • Post-Remediation Verification: After our work is concluded, our mold testing protocols often include post-remediation testing to ensure that mold spore counts have returned to normal levels, providing absolute peace of mind for our North Port, Florida clients.
  • Detailed Remediation Plan Development: Based on the assessment and sampling results, our technicians at Mold and Basement Mold Removal North Port, Florida will formulate a personalized remediation plan. This plan outlines:
    • Containment Strategies: How we will isolate the mold-impacted spaces to prevent mold spores from spreading to unaffected parts of your North Port, Florida home.
    • Moisture Control Measures: Guidance and implementation strategies to address and correct the moisture source. This might involve fixing plumbing, roof, or foundation, or upgrades of ventilation systems.
    • Safe Removal Protocols: A step-by-step approach for the physical removal of mold, focusing on safety for both our technicians and your building occupants.
    • Air Purification Techniques: Approaches for purifying the air both during and post the remediation process.
  • Implementing Long-Term Solutions: The heart of thorough mold remediation is preventing its return. Our team focuses on applying measures that go beyond superficial cleaning.
    • Humidity Regulation:Advising on or placing dehumidifiers, particularly critical for North Port, Florida basements and crawlspaces.
    • Improved Ventilation:Ensuring proper airflow in moisture-prone areas.
    • Waterproofing Solutions: For basements and foundations, addressing vulnerabilities to water infiltration.
    • Education for Homeowners: Giving you with the insight and strategies to maintain a mold-free environment.

Our Rigorous Mold Removal Process In North Port, Florida

  • Containment and Isolation: Before any removal begins, stopping mold from spreading is essential. Our team establishes secure containment zones around the affected areas using:
      • Sealed Barriers: Heavy-duty plastic sheeting and airtight seals isolate the contaminated space from the rest of your North Port, Florida home.
      • Negative Air Machines: These powerful units create negative air pressure within the containment zone, effectively drawing airborne mold spores into specialized HEPA filters. This is a critical step to maintain your indoor air quality.
      • Safety Protocols for Technicians and Occupants: Our team’s safety, and yours, is our top priority. Our technicians utilize:
        •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Full-body suits, respirators, gloves, and eye protection shield our experts from direct contact with mold spores.
        • Controlled Entry/Exit: Designated entry and exit points reduce the risk of tracking mold spores outside.
    • Physical Removal of Mold: This is where the actual eradication takes place. Depending on the type of material and the extent of growth, our techniques for mold removal in North Port, Florida include:
      • Non-Porous Surfaces: For surfaces like metal, glass, or hard plastics, mold can often be aggressively cleaned using our safe remediation treatments.
      • Porous and Semi-Porous Materials: Items like drywall, insulation, carpeting, and upholstered furniture that are heavily contaminated often require careful, controlled removal. Our team ensures these materials are bagged and sealed within the containment area before being removed from your property, preventing further spread.
      • Detailed Cleaning: All affected surfaces are meticulously cleaned using our proprietary EPA-registered mold removal product. This targets mold at a molecular level without harsh chemicals, ensuring complete eradication.
      • Encapsulation (if necessary): In some instances, after thorough cleaning and drying, certain non-removable surfaces might be treated with an encapsulating agent to provide extra protection.
    • Air Filtration and Purification: Throughout the mold removal process and often for a period afterward, we continuously operate:
      • HEPA Air Scrubbers: These machines draw in air and pass it through High-Efficiency Particulate Air (HEPA) filters, trapping microscopic mold spores, dust, pollen, and other allergens. This significantly improves the overall indoor air quality of your North Port, Florida home.
      • Dehumidifiers: Industrial-grade dehumidifiers are deployed to bring humidity levels down to optimal ranges. This is especially important for basement mold removal in North Port, Florida.
    • Drying and Structural Drying: After physical removal and cleaning, ensuring all areas are thoroughly dry is critical. Our team uses industrial dehumidifiers to protect structural integrity.

Recognizing the Enemy: Signs of Mold in Your North Port, Florida Home

Mold is cunning; it often establishes itself in out-of-sight locations before showing visible signs. However, your senses and careful observation can be key methods in detecting its presence. Noticing mold early in your North Port, Florida home can save you significant time, money, and potential health issues.

Key Indicators to Watch Out For:

Musty Odor: This is often the first and most common sign. Mold produces microbial volatile organic compounds (MVOCs), which create a distinct, musty smell. If you notice a continuous musty odor in your home, especially after rain, it’s a strong indicator of hidden mold, even if you see no surface mold.
Consider: Do you smell it more strongly in certain areas? Does running vents make it worse?

Visible Growth: Mold can appear in different forms and shades, depending on the species and the surface.

  • Colors: Shades like black, green, white, gray, yellow, blue, or even pink/orange. Dark mold is often the most worrisome in North Port, Florida properties, but every mold color warrants attention.

  • Textures: Can feel fuzzy, slimy, powdery, or resemble cotton.

  • Locations: Check walls, ceilings, floors, window sills, carpets, or pipes for patches. Dont forget hidden areas like the backs of closets, under sinks, or behind furniture, especially in damp zones.

Water Stains or Discoloration: Unexpected stains or color changes on any surface can indicate past or current water intrusion, which is a key factor for mold development. Even if the stain seems harmless, mold may thrive behind the surface.
Pay attention to: Brownish-yellow stains, bubbling or peeling paint, or warped drywallthese are common warning signs in North Port, Florida homes.

Condensation: Persistent condensation on any surface can trigger mold growth. While some moisture is expected, ongoing moisture is a warning sign.
Look for: Recurring wet marks on walls or windows.

Peeling, Bubbling, or Cracking Paint/Wallpapers: Excess humidity can cause paint or wallpaper to lose adhesion, providing prime breeding grounds for mold.

Warped or Cupped Flooring/Wood: Excess moisture can cause wood flooring, subflooring, or structural wood to swell, warp, or cup. Mold growth often follows these signs. Basement mold problems in North Port, Florida commonly involve such issues.

Unexplained Health Symptoms: Mold exposure can cause allergic or respiratory problems, especially in sensitive individuals. Watch for:

  • Frequent sneezing, nasal congestion, or watery eyes

  • Coughing and wheezing

  • Skin irritation or rashes

  • Chronic headaches or migraines

  • Low energy or brain fog

  • Eye irritation

  • Asthma flare-ups without apparent cause, especially when at home

Symptoms that improve when leaving or entering your North Port, Florida home may indicate mold exposure.

Damp or Leaky Areas: Regularly inspect moist hotspots in your North Port, Florida property:

  • Basements and Crawl Spaces: High-risk zones. Look for white powdery buildup, showing moisture intrusion. Basement mold in North Port, Florida is a pervasive issue.

  • Bathrooms: Inspect wet areas like sinks and tubs.

  • Kitchens: Inspect under sinks, near dishwashers, and refrigerators.

Attics: Check after storms or for signs of trapped moisture.

North Port is a city located in Sarasota County, Florida, United States. The population was 74,793 at the 2020 US Census. It is part of the North Port–Bradenton–Sarasota Metropolitan Statistical Area. It was originally developed by General Development Corporation as the northern / Sarasota County portion of its Port Charlotte development, the other portion located in the adjacent Charlotte County. GDC dubbed the city North Port Charlotte, and it was incorporated under that name through a special act of the Florida Legislature in 1959. By referendum in 1974, the city's residents approved a change to its name as North Port, dropping Charlotte from its name to proclaim the city as a separate identity. It is home to the Little Salt Spring, an archaeological and paleontological site owned by the University of Miami.
